`Using` section contains list of **assemblies** in wich configuration methods (`WriteTo.File()`, `Enrich.WithThreadId()`) resides.

```json
"Serilog": {
"Using": [ "Serilog.Sinks.Console", "Serilog.Enrichers.Thread", /* ... */ ],
// ...
}
```

For .NET Core projects build tools produce `.deps.json` files and this package implements a convention using `Microsoft.Extensions.DependencyModel` to find any package among dependencies with `Serilog` anywhere in the name and pulls configuration methods from it, so the `Using` section in example above can be ommitted:
